Épinal castle and grounds
Built around the middle of the 13th century at an altitude of 387m, the
Château d'Épinal nestles in a 27-hectare park. Although the château is now in ruins, you can still visit the grounds freely:
- A medieval garden
- A wildlife park
- Walking trails
- A carousel
Address: 26 rue Saint-Michel
Saint-Maurice Basilica
Founded in the
11th century, the
Basilica of Saint-Maurice stands out for its silhouette, which has evolved over the centuries. Its dimensions are impressive: 68 metres long and a nave that rises to a height of 14 metres. Inside, paintings and sculptures abound. Special mention should be made of the rich 19th-century stained glass windows.
Address: Place Saint-Goery
The Departmental Museum of Ancient and Contemporary Art
Épinal's main museum, it features over 30,000 works from Antiquity to the 20th century. Painting, sculpture, decorative arts, archaeology, numismatics... an exceptional wealth! Among the masterpieces on display are
- Job mocked by his wife by Georges de La Tour (circa 1630)
- Summer and Winter by Jan Brueghel (late 16th, early 17th century)
- Naked Faith by Gilbert Proesch (1982)
Address: 8 rue de la Préfecture. Price: €8/adult, €3 concessions.
